Transaction 2f391567656272ba7513915b045786c01a781f7a01e7a11d14eda05ffddce379
1 Input
2 Outputs
- 2f391567656272ba7513915b045786c01a781f7a01e7a11d14eda05ffddce379:0
- 2f391567656272ba7513915b045786c01a781f7a01e7a11d14eda05ffddce379:1
value 513802
address 3NBQoqHL7gZyWuqYUshddRe96HMCndzcaT
value 1116580900
address 1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V